Chester Town Crier

Enjoy the flamboyant declaration of the Chester Town Crier in the heart of the City at the ancient Cross, at the junction of Bridge Street, Watergate Street and Eastgate Street. The shout which usually lasts about 15 minutes begins at 12 noon every Tuesday to Saturday from Easter to the end of September.

Chester Racecourse

The oldest horse races in Britain, staged on the Roodee, once the site of the massive Roman harbour. Chester Racecourse is now ranked as the 4th best attended in the whole of Britain, averaging 18,000 visitors per day at its race meetings.

Guided Walking Tours of Chester

Pastfinder Tour - The best way to discover Chester's 2000 years of history.

Ghosthunter Trail - Take a night-time journey around the eerie haunts of Chester's mysterious and murky past. Hear spine-chilling tales of ghosts, ghouls and things that go bump in the night.

Roman Soldier Patrols - Patrol Fortress Deva with Caius Julius Quartus! In full battle gear, he takes you on patrol and evokes the exciting adventures of an Imperial warrior.

Quiz tours (treasure hunts): Guided walk and quiz finishing at one of Chester's best loved inns or taverns.

Cromwell's Troops: Highwaymen and Press gangs.

Tudor Lady Walk: With the City's infamous eloper, Eleanor Aldersey recalling her life and times in Merrie England. In costume, weather permitting.

Literary Chester: Follow in the footsteps of some of our greatest writers who lived in or visited Chester.

Curious Chester, Myths and Legends: Unlock the secrets of the City's past, delve into its uncovered mysteries and its unusual claims to fame.
